At Sichuan Museum, a special exhibition is now open to mark the 80th anniversary of the victory in the Chinese People's War of Resistance Against Japanese Aggression (1931-45) and the World Anti-Fascist War.
With 306 artifacts from 49 cultural and archival institutions across China, alongside a wealth of precious historical photographs, the exhibition vividly recreates the powerful story of how the people of Sichuan—across all walks of life—stood united to defend the nation.
Dates: Until Dec 10
